Hills Road Sixth Form College is looking for a professional, highly organised Estates and Compliance Manager (ECM) to join its busy Estates Team.
Job details
Salary: £44,544 per annum (Support Staff Pay Spine Point 28)
Contract: Permanent, Full time
Closing date: Monday 2nd June 2025 at 9am
Interviews: Week commencing Monday 16th June 2025
About this role
This role is primarily an office-based, administrative position that will report to our Director of Estates. The successful candidate will organise all routine maintenance and repairs carried out by either our team of skilled Caretakers or a range of external contractors, at our extensive site located on Hills Road, Cambridge.
This is a facilitating, administrative role that requires an individual with a core skill set that includes capacity, organisation, attention to detail, project management, and diplomatic skills that can be delivered across a wide range of teams. Prior technical knowledge of facilities management is not a requirement, but the successful candidate must have an open, learning mindset and willingness to learn about the estate and its services. Knowledge and experience of working within the education sector, whilst desirable, is also not essential. However, all candidates need to have an understanding of the range of needs of a diverse workforce and be committed to making a difference to young people's lives.
We offer great teamwork and a varied workload, an attractive salary, 24 days' annual leave, rising to 27 after five years' service, plus bank holidays, and a wide range of competitive benefits including a generous pension scheme, free use of the College sporting facilities, free on-site parking, a cycle to work scheme, as well as discounts on all our Adult Education courses.
